Morning: Start your day with a visit to the iconic Amber Fort, a magnificent fortress located on a hilltop. Explore the intricate architecture and take a guided tour to learn about the rich history of Jaipur. Don't miss the breathtaking panoramic views of Jaipur city from the fort.
Afternoon: Head to the City Palace, a grand palace complex that showcases a blend of Rajasthani and Mughal architectural styles. Discover the numerous palaces, courtyards, and museums within the palace complex, and don't forget to visit the fascinating armory and textile museum.
Evening: Conclude your day with a visit to Chokhi Dhani, an ethnic village resort that offers a glimpse into Rajasthani culture and traditions. Enjoy traditional dance performances, camel rides, and indulge in authentic Rajasthani cuisine.
Morning: Start your day by visiting the Jal Mahal, a beautiful palace situated in the middle of the Man Sagar Lake. Take a stroll along the lake and admire the stunning architecture of the palace.
Afternoon: Explore the Jantar Mantar, an astronomical observatory built by Maharaja Sawai Jai Singh II. Marvel at the colossal instruments used for precise astronomical calculations.
Evening: Spend the evening at the Birla Mandir, a magnificent temple dedicated to Lord Vishnu and Goddess Lakshmi. Witness the evening Aarti (prayer ceremony) and enjoy the serene atmosphere.
Morning: Visit the Jaipur Zoo, a popular attraction for families. Explore the diverse wildlife and enjoy a leisurely walk amidst the lush greenery of the zoo.
Afternoon: Experience the thrill of Nahargarh Fort, situated on the Aravalli Hills. Enjoy a scenic drive to the fort and marvel at the panoramic views of Jaipur. You can also visit the Jaigarh Fort, located nearby, to witness the impressive collection of ancient weapons.
Evening: Indulge in some shopping at the bustling markets of Jaipur. Johari Bazaar and Bapu Bazaar are famous for their traditional jewelry, textiles, handicrafts, and more.
For a unique experience, visit the Anokhi Museum of Hand Printing, which showcases the rich textile heritage of Jaipur. Learn about traditional block printing techniques and explore the stunning textile exhibits.
Another off the beaten path attraction is the Sisodia Rani Garden and Palace, a serene garden filled with beautiful frescoes depicting the love story of Radha and Krishna.
